Transaction 681e8988f4d63c42b8cea44d7d3d41fb1284586caaa2c9c01ead5bbf1622878d
1 Input
1 Output
-
681e8988f4d63c42b8cea44d7d3d41fb1284586caaa2c9c01ead5bbf1622878d:0
- value
- 18533927
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a92b665907456fc42d8b252ec61a7c170036dd8e OP_EQUAL
- address
- 3H7W7S7Vxd4uaZKgN3V2vB4BNoLGYbEYTS